Virginia has embraced the efficiency of remote online notary services. These technologies allow individuals to complete notarial acts electronically from any location with an internet connection. Utilizing a secure platform and audio-visual communication, remote notarizations in Virginia guarantee the validity of documents while streamlining the process for both parties involved.

A certified notary public performs the remote notarization through a live video conference, verifying the signer's identity and witnessing their signature. This procedure adheres to Virginia's statutory requirements for click here notary services, offering a secure and reliable alternative to traditional in-person notarizations.
